Killing Them Softly

Jackie Cogan is an enforcer hired to restore order after three dumb guys rob a Mob protected card game, causing the local criminal economy to collapse.

grantss
2016/09/23

Good crime-drama. Interesting, gritty, plot and quirky, Tarantinoesque, dialogue. Not great though: no real twists - everything pans out pretty much like you expected it would. Is a political allegory, and the almost-constant political news and speeches was irritating, but does get a bit too preachy towards the end. The point made at the end did sum up modern America well, but it seemed to lack context and felt like the entire movie was made just for the soundbite at the end. Good performances from Brad Pitt, James Gandolfini and Ben Mendelsohn.

This paragraph is a quite a tangent, but, if you are interested in seeing this movie, I highly suggest you read it. This is not, and I mean NOT (N-O-T), an action movie. There are some scenes with a bit of action in them, but they're all very brief. This movie is a slow- moving thriller, and is very reliant on it's dialogue.So, I just saw Killing Them Softly recently, and these are my thoughts.Killing Them Softly is a Crime Thriller that does not focus on the glorification, nor the extreme shame, that the actual Crime gets in other movies. This movie is actually about the people that commit those Crimes. Killing Them Softly is interesting, due to the fact that almost every single character is a terrible person, who has done terrible things, but, they are also one of the most strangely relate-able bunch of characters I've seen in a while. Every single character has at least something going for them, and, despite their aberrant flaws, it's shocking when something happens to them. I also really enjoyed the little bits of Dark Humor in this film (at least, that's what I thought it was), the performances (especially from Brad Pitt), were really good, and the cinematography was decent.However, this movie is NOT perfect! Although there are more flaws if you nitpick it enough (as with anything), there is one main flaw I found this movie: it's not-so great presentation of story. Don't get me wrong, this film has a very interesting story, and when it opens up, it actually provokes a bit of thought... however, that stuff didn't hit me until more than half-way through the film. The way the filmmakers chose to write the story is very troublesome in the bits and pieces before that more-than-half-way mark, mainly because it's pretty hard to follow. Throughout the opening, I kept saying to myself 'Okay, now you've lost me', which is a bad sign.In total, I'm glad I saw Killing Them Softly. Perfect? No, but not as mediocre as some people will tell you it is.
